Katie Elzer-Peters tells us about kitchen gardening. That is, gardening in the kitchen -- with leftover greens, seeds, and roots.

We talk about growing:
  • sweet potato
  • carrots
  • lettuce
  • celery
  • beets
  • green onions
  • leeks
  • turmeric
  • ginger

And saving seeds from squash and tomatoes.

Katie's is the author of No-Waste Kitchen Gardening: Regrow Your Leftover Greens, Stalks, Seeds, and More.
